So here it is!
STEP 1: at about 30 minutes before your normal sleeping time, load up on acetylcholine, drink apple juice, eat m&ms’s drink coffee, and eat apple pie. These foods are fantastic in increasing acetylcholine levels in the brain.
STEP 2: Watch a tv show or listen to music while falling asleep. With music, keep the volume about halfway up and on tv keep it at 15
STEP 3: Drink about as much water as your height (if your 5 ‘8 or 5 4’ or 5 1’ drink five cups of water ). If you have ever wet your bed before just set an alarm or make yourself wake up using your body’s internal alarm clock.
STEP 4: Lay down in bed and think about past dreams ( if you’ve had lucid dreams make sure to think about those as it’s even better than just thinking about dreams). Try image rescripting where you remember a dream and imagine you got lucid in it
STEP 5: cycle through your sense. first do your vision. while having your eyes closed focus on the blackness behind your eyes for about 30 seconds try to look for floaters or a static like image. Then focus on the hearing for about 30 seconds listen to the tv show and try to focus on the dialogue. Then focus on the touch for about 30 seconds. Cycle through these until either you can see floaters or see static (this should happen at about 3-4 cycles) or you’ve done 4-5 cycles.
STEP 6: fall asleep while doing the reverse blinking method. Keep your eyes closed and about every 10 seconds open your eyes and focus on an object in your room just enough so you can see it clearly then close your eyes. Repeat this for as long as you need to get tired then just fall asleep as normal.
STEP 7: Now you’ve woken up after about 3-4 hours. First do a reality check get up and hold your nose and try to breathe through your nose (do this about 3 times because your might still be dreaming if you still can’t look at your hands to see if you have any extra fingers if you still don’t see anything unusual, your probably actually awake but if you can breathe through your nose or see extra fingers you Lucid! If not lucid, continue the steps) think about if you remember any dreams if you did write them down, you might have already had a lucid dream and just forgot about it already. If you can’t remember any dreams that’s okay. Get up and use the bathroom if you use the water technique, if you set an alarm, just stay in bed. Turn the tv show you had on while you had your first half of sleep back on. Keep the volume at about 15 on the tv, halfway on music.
STEP 8: Once again, load up on acetylcholines but this time, avoid coffee.
STEP 9: Think about past dreams and lucid ones if you’ve had them, do image rescripting once again.
STEP 10: repeat step 5
STEP 11: once that’s done, repeat step 6
That should be it.
